Travis Kelce's Heartfelt Proposal to Taylor Swift: Insights from His Father
A Special Moment Unveiled
Ed Kelce, the father of NFL star Travis Kelce, has shared intimate details about his son's romantic proposal to pop sensation Taylor Swift. According to Ed, the proposal took place nearly two weeks ago, confirming earlier reports regarding the engagement date.
Initially, Ed mentioned that the proposal occurred in a garden in Lee's Summit, Missouri. However, it was later revealed that the actual location was Travis's backyard in Leawood, Kansas. Ed received the exciting news shortly after the proposal when Travis and Taylor called him during an Eagles practice session.
Ed recounted, 'He got her out there, they were about to go out to dinner, and he said, ‘Let’s go out and have a glass of wine.’ That’s when he asked her, and it was beautiful.'
Travis had considered postponing the proposal for a grander occasion, but Ed advised him that the moment's significance could be felt anywhere, as long as it was heartfelt.
The couple shared their joy with their families via FaceTime, ensuring everyone was included in the celebration. Ed expressed his happiness upon seeing them together, stating, 'As soon as I saw the FaceTime, I knew what they were going to say.'
Photos from the day captured the couple in a blissful embrace, celebrating their engagement with love and joy.
To commemorate their engagement, Travis presented Taylor with a stunning custom-made ring. He collaborated with jeweler Kindred Lubeck from Artifex Fine to design a unique piece featuring an old mine brilliant-cut diamond set in a classic gold bezel.
